    RBR MF Cup - S2 - Round 5 Acropolis Rally

    *No pic at this stage due to yet another uploading site that doesn't frigging work anymore!!! Running out of them quickly here*

    Acropolis Rally Event Info
    -----------------------------
    12-14 March 2010
    RBR MF Cup Season 2 - Round 5

    Rules
    -----
    Open to WRC, S2000, N4-N1 and A7-A5 cars
    Tyre choice is free for all stages
    Pacenotes - Audio only, not visual
    One SuperRally per leg, 3min penalty for each SuperRally used.

    Stages
    ------
    Leg 1
    SS1 - Tanner (Japan) - Mod: Normal - Weather: Cloudy Damp - 3.9km
    SS2 - Pikes Peak (BTB) - Mod: Normal - Weather: Clear - 19.4km
    SS3 - Jourdain (New stages) - Mod: Normal - Weather: Clear - 5.5km

    Leg 2
    SS4 - Joux Plane (France) - Mod: Gravel - Weather: Clear - 11.1km
    SS5 - Canyon (New Stages) - Mod: Gravel - Weather: Clear - 2.1km
    SS6 - Joux Verte (France) - Mod: Gravel - Weather: Clear - 7.9km

    Leg 3
    SS7 - Joux Plane II (France) - Mod: Gravel - Weather: Light fog - 11.1km
    SS8 - Cote D'Arbroz II (France) - Mod: Gravel - Weather: Clear - 4.3km
    SS9 - Pribram (New stages) - Mod: Gravel - Weather: Clear - 9.1km

    Total Distance - 74.4km

    Entries
    -------
    Send your entries to BruceD by PM or by email to [email:3gk4wlzh]rbrmfcup@gmail.com[/email:3gk4wlzh] Entry info as follows: Name, Country, Team, Car.

    Submitting times
    ----------------
    Start each stage using the "RSRBR2009" button under the "play alone" section, do your stage. The time will be recorded in the window at the bottom of RsCenter. If its not recorded, you did something wrong. Use "public sessions" tab and "Go" button for BTB stages.

    Once you have completed the stages you wish to do, select the File menu and click on "Save times" The times are saved to your RBR directory under the folder "MyTimes". Once you have done all the stages, send all your html files to [email:3gk4wlzh]rbrmfcup@gmail.com[/email:3gk4wlzh] to be scored. Please note that more than 1 html file can be submitted so you don't have to do all the stages at one time.

    Entries open immediately. Rally and entries close at midnight Tuesday 16th March 2010
